From a3a9933cf1b49006edf470615236f94ebdaa4cb9 Mon Sep 17 00:00:00 2001
From: yangys <y_ys79@sina.com>
Date: 星期三, 03 九月 2025 17:04:24 +0800
Subject: [PATCH] 增加车床程序处理;退回改为实际编程员

---
 blade-service/blade-mdm/src/main/java/org/springblade/mdm/flow/service/FlowBusinessService.java |   22 +++++++++++-----------
 1 files changed, 11 insertions(+), 11 deletions(-)

diff --git a/blade-service/blade-mdm/src/main/java/org/springblade/mdm/flow/service/FlowBusinessService.java b/blade-service/blade-mdm/src/main/java/org/springblade/mdm/flow/service/FlowBusinessService.java
index 5b8613e..860ab08 100644
--- a/blade-service/blade-mdm/src/main/java/org/springblade/mdm/flow/service/FlowBusinessService.java
+++ b/blade-service/blade-mdm/src/main/java/org/springblade/mdm/flow/service/FlowBusinessService.java
@@ -156,7 +156,6 @@
 			if(ru.isSuccess()) {
 				flow.setStartUserName(ru.getData().getName());
 			}
-			;
 			List<Comment> comments = lastStepComments(task);//taskService.getTaskComments(task.getId());
 			if(!comments.isEmpty()){
 				flow.setComment(comments.get(0).getFullMessage());
@@ -203,15 +202,7 @@
 			return Collections.emptyList();
 		}
 	}
-	/**
-	 * 鑾峰彇鍘嗗彶娴佺▼
-	 *
-	 * @param processInstanceId 娴佺▼瀹炰緥id
-	 * @return HistoricProcessInstance
-	 */
-	private HistoricProcessInstance getHistoricProcessInstance(String processInstanceId) {
-		return historyService.createHistoricProcessInstanceQuery().processInstanceId(processInstanceId).singleResult();
-	}
+
 
 	public IPage<FlowVO> selectAllTaskPage(IPage<FlowVO> page, String keyword) {
 
@@ -377,6 +368,11 @@
 			vo.setProcessCreateTime(processInstance.getStartTime());
 			vo.setHistoryTaskEndTime(processInstance.getEndTime());
 
+			R<User> ru = userClient.userInfoById(Long.valueOf(processInstance.getStartUserId()));
+			if(ru.isSuccess()) {
+				vo.setStartUserName(ru.getData().getName());
+			}
+
 			vo.setFile(getFileString(processInstance.getId()));
 			records.add(vo);
 		}
@@ -442,7 +438,10 @@
 
 			vo.setProcessCreateTime(processInstance.getStartTime());
 			vo.setHistoryTaskEndTime(processInstance.getEndTime());
-
+			R<User> ru = userClient.userInfoById(Long.valueOf(processInstance.getStartUserId()));
+			if(ru.isSuccess()) {
+				vo.setStartUserName(ru.getData().getName());
+			}
 			vo.setFile(getFileString(processInstance.getId()));
 			records.add(vo);
 		}
@@ -550,4 +549,5 @@
 
 		return page;
 	}
+
 }

--
Gitblit v1.9.3